Disney XD Will Air the Super Smash Bros. Finals

Discussion in 'Gaming News' started by GameFans, Jul 14, 2017.

  1. This Sunday at 6PM ET, you'll be able to watch the EVO finals for Super Smash Bros for Wii U on Disney XD. You can also watch it streaming on Twitch. Disney XD will have its own people commenting the game.
    Last edited by a moderator: Jul 14, 2017

Share This Page